Microsoft Dynamics
365 CRM
Dynamics 365 CRM Partner in Canada
We help Canadian teams evaluate licenses, design processes, integrate with Business Central, and roll out automation that users actually adopt. From discovery through build, testing, training, and go-live, we set up entities, security, forms, views, and reports so your team can work faster with clean data. Need workflow automation and AI capabilities? We configure Power Automate flows and help you decide where Copilot adds real value, keeping technology practical and measurable for your business.
What Joesoftware offers as your partner
Demonstrated experience with CRM implementations and integrations
Designing you business CRM workflows to deliver your business processes
Exceptional service and support when you need it
How will Dynamics 365 CRM Solutions benefit you?
Security and convenience
Manage your business on-premise, remotely or in the field with this cloud-based CRM system.
Account and contact information
Scalability
A CRM that streamlines every day processes and can be scaled and adapted as your company grows and moves into new markets.
Collaboration
Enable Teams chat conversations within the Sales Hub and connect them to records.
Robust reporting and analytics
Track organizational progress with dashboards and charts driven by Power BI.
Use Cases
Sales
Customer Service
Deliver omnichannel case management with integrated knowledge bases, SLA tracking, and voice and chat add-ons to resolve customer issues quickly across every communication channel.
Field Service
Power Automate
Dataverse integration with Business Central
Professional services
Customer support centers
Field operations
ERP/3rd-Party Integrations
Job setup
Configure project cards, tasks, budgets, and planning lines to establish clear scope, timelines, and cost expectations before work begins.
Resources
Define people and equipment resources with their capacity, pricing rates, and allocations to ensure accurate costing and optimal utilization across all projects.
Time & expense
Capture timesheets, route approvals, post job journals, and link purchases directly to jobs so every cost is tracked accurately and billing reflects actual work performed.
Budgeting & Change Control
Establish job budgets with cost and sales amounts, manage revisions and change orders through planning lines, and track estimates versus actuals to control scope changes and profitability.
Progress Billing & Invoicing
Generate milestone and percentage-based invoices from job planning, use multiple invoice types to partially bill work, and link to WIP to keep revenue and cost recognition accurate.
WIP & Period Close
Reporting & Dashboards
“We had such a great experience working with the team at Joesoftware. They helped make our payroll processing and time management much more efficient, and shared their vast knowledge of Canadian GP. Terri and Chi Cheong were patient, accommodating and are still quick to answer our emails, even after we’ve implemented the new products.”
Christina Fagan, HR, Fortis Inc.
Joesoftware can put a CRM solution to work for your business.
Joesoftware works with for-profit and non-profits companies of all sizes across Alberta, British Columbia and other parts of Canada. We’d love to talk with you, understand your needs and help you determine if Dynamics 365 is the right CRM for your business.
Frequently Asked Questions
Most teams mean Sales, Customer Service, and Field Service—licensed separately under the Customer Engagement family.
Sales Professional is listed at $88.20/user/month, Enterprise at $142.50/user/month, and Premium at $203.50/user/month (USD, paid yearly). Check Microsoft’s page for current pricing in your region.
Customer Service Professional is listed at $67.80, Enterprise at $142.50, and Premium at $264.60 per user/month (USD, paid yearly). Regional availability and currency may vary.
Field Service is listed at $142.50/user/month (USD, paid yearly).
Yes,Dataverse provides the standard connection model between BC and apps like Dynamics 365 Sales for customer, order, and related data.
Power Automate adds cross-app workflows (approvals, notifications, sync) inside BC/CRM and Microsoft 365.
Core pipeline management with options for forecasting, embedded intelligence, and premium AI features.